IDFC First Bank acquires title rights for India’s home international fixtures for three years

IDFC First Bank has reportedly bought the rights for INR 4.2 crore per international fixture.

The Indian private sector bank, IDFC First Bank has bagged the title rights to the home international series of the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) for three years.

IDFC First has reportedly bought the rights for INR 4.2 crore per international fixture, which is a 40-lakh hike from the previous price of INR 3.8 crore. The base price for securing the rights set by the BCCI was INR 2.4 crore.

The association between the two parties involved will kick off next month with the Australia tour of India, which consists of three ODIs. The arrangement is valid till August 2026 and includes 56 international fixtures.

In the bidding process, IDFC First managed to outbid the sports broadcasting baron, Sony Sports, which was planning to enter into the title sponsorship arena for the first time.
